Job Title: Maintenance Officer
Location: Niger State
Job Summary
The Job Holder oversees the following:
Facility Management: The running of the Cleaning Division, Diesel, Water, and Electricity management, Internet, Stationaries and Kitchen Purchases. Overall management of the Facility Building and its interior.
Supervisory Function: Oversee and line manage the following department, Cleaning department, Security department, Kitchen Section, logistic/Driving Department.
Maintenance: Supervises Generator, Electrical, Plumbing and other related maintenance practices.
Core Job Functions
Cleaning:
Manage the cleaning and hygiene of the facility.
Diesel:
Procure diesel from cost and product effective supplier.
Ensures the generator is filled up regularly and locked up with the measurement taken daily to confirm quantity and next purchase.
Ensures the generator record book is completed each time diesel is purchased.
Water:
Ensures the Facility always has water.
Electricity:
Ensures the Facility always has electricity
Monitors the consumption rate
Kitchen purchases:
Purchased food items should be monitored to ensure effectiveness.
Check on store usage on weekly basis to ensure proper use
Monitor use of gas cylinders to ensure both cylinders never run out at the same time.
Vehicle:
Ensure accurate record of mileage, fuelling and servicing are kept by drivers.
Monitor the quality and quantity of fuel purchased by drivers.
Generator:
Monitor the use and maintenance of the Generator.
Ensure record for maintenance are kept
Electrical, Plumbing, Carpentry & other maintenance activities:
Oversees the interior of the Facility and is charge of all repair and maintenance work required.
Ensure all the repair works are done by qualified technicians.
Waste Disposal
Ensure waste are disposed properly and their bills paid either monthly or annually; to avoid backlog.
Procurement Duties:
Process purchase requisitions / orders within purchasing Period.
Invite, assess, and award/recommend supplier tenders, bids, quotations, and proposals
Establish and negotiate contract terms and conditions, and maintain supplier relationships
Prepare and maintain purchasing records, reports and price lists
Work with the admin department to determine procurement needs, quality, and delivery requirements
Assist in the development of specifications for equipment, materials, and services to be purchased
Administer contract performance, including delivery, receipt, warranty, damages and insurance
Reconcile or resolve value discrepancies
Comply with and maintain knowledge of applicable rules, legislation, regulations, standards, and best practices
Develop and maintain constructive and cooperative working relationships with colleagues and management
Any other duty assigned to the Officer by the Management
